Roy Denoon has specialized in wind engineering for over 30 years, working on a wide range of projects around the globe, from major sports stadia to some of the world’s tallest buildings. He has published numerous magazine and journal articles in the field, serves on multiple committees and has contributed to the development of standards and guidelines in many jurisdictions. He co-authored the CTBUH Guide to Wind Tunnel Testing of High-Rise Buildings and was a primary author of both the ASCE Manual of Practice on Design and Performance of Tall Buildings for Wind and the ASCE Pre-standard for Performance-Based Wind Design. He is a Fellow of CTBUH.
